Output 63c915ffaef0809cdd956e65528bd8ef1985a6874f8d9c84054d7a305c5e9008:0

value
3578232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ae585fa73c4155ffc38a03a7aa27019eb36f2f3 OP_EQUAL
address
3JjEZnZXSaEQ19PQAxnm6qYDpeJTfXnN1H
transaction
63c915ffaef0809cdd956e65528bd8ef1985a6874f8d9c84054d7a305c5e9008
spent
true